In the darkest corners of the Proxion Sector, where the flames of battle never cease, Spiritseer Invath found himself in a rather tight spot. His once-mighty wraithhost had been depleted after countless battles and he did not have the forces at hand to take on the presence of Chaos in the sector. With an uncanny knack for negotiating the impossible, Invath managed to forge a most peculiar alliance as he found himself facing the Grot commander Gitbang Boomdakka. Their mission? To combat the dreaded Khorne Chaos Space Marines led by the fearsome Angron. And their terms? Well, let's just say it was a deal that could only be described as, well, grotsome...

Invath, his tall elegant figure standing against the short, squabbling masses of Grots, cleared his throat. "General Boomdakka, we sh--"...

"Dat's General-ADMIRAL Boomdakka to you, pointy-ears!" quickly inserted the grot leader.

Invath rolled his eyes and continued, "...we shall allow your Grots to pillage all the loot from this battle and the nearby city ruins, in exchange for your... 'assistance'."

Boomdakka, perched atop a rickety Grot tank, scratched his head with a wrench. "Lootin', lootin', ya say? Dat sounds right proppa, dat does! But what's in it fer ya? We ain't no fancy space elves."

Invath cringed inwardly but pressed on.  "You see, General, beneath th..."

"GENERAL-ADMIRAL!" interupted the grot, again.

"Yes, of course... beneath this desolate battlefield lies ancient Eldar ruins. We wish to explore them."

Boomdakka raised an eyebrow, or at least what passed for an eyebrow on a Grot. "Fancy elf ruins, eh? Sounds like a right laugh. We got a deal!"

And so, an uneasy peace was struck, as the Eldar spiritseers reluctantly agreed to rely on the Grots, whom they regarded as inferior beings fit only for cannon fodder.

The battle began, and to everyone's surprise, especially Boomdakka's, the Grots were far more effective than expected. Grot mek guns, held together with duct tape, fired with uncanny accuracy, hitting Chaos Space Marines square in the... well, in their chaos bits. Grot tanks, which seemed to be held together by sheer force of collective will, rumbled forward, lobbing explosives like they were squigs in a food fight. But the real highlight of the battle was when the Grot tanks, in a burst of audacity, launched an... overconfident... charge at Angron himself. The plan was simple: overwhelm him with sheer Grot power... and hope for the best.

As they charged, Angron, the towering and bloodied daemon Primarch, looked down in bemusement.

The Grot tanks, an assorted collection of mismatched contraptions, rushed ahead with wild abandon, clanking and sparking as they went. It was a sight to behold, a clash of civilizations like no other! But alas, as they converged on the deamon, disaster struck. Angron, with a single sweep of his axe, sent most of the tanks spiraling into oblivion. Explosions rocked the battlefield, and Grot shrapnel filled the air. The majority of the Grot tanks were obliterated in one spectacular fiery display. However, the explosions caused by a few of the tanks were enough to engulf Angron in a storm of shrapnel and fire. In a twist of fate that could only be described as downright ludicrous, the Grots had succeeded in taking down the giant daemon Primarch...

As the smoke cleared, Spiritseer Invath couldn't help but shake his head in disbelief. The Grots had done it... The battlefield was a smoldering mess of twisted metal and chaos-infused gore, but they had prevailed.

And so it was that the unlikely alliance between the Eldar and the Grots held, even if they still regarded each other with mutual disdain. As for Angron, he would forever be known as the daemon Primarch who met his end at the hands of a Grot charge. A truly grotsome tale for the ages....
